which of the following is not a type of opportunistic infection common to hiv/aids positive people?
a. hereditary
b. viral
c. bacterial
d. parasitic
please select the best answer from the choices provided.
a
b
c
d

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

Opportunistic infections in HIV/AIDS patients are acquired, not hereditary. Viral (e.g., cytomegalovirus), bacterial (e.g., Mycobacterium tuberculosis), and parasitic (e.g., Toxoplasma gondii) infections are common opportunistic infections in this population. Hereditary conditions are passed genetically and not related to the opportunistic nature of infections in HIV/AIDS.

Answer:

A. hereditary
